Clubhouse filled in for going out and talking to people.

I don’t think their decline is any great mystery. Concern about the pandemic declined, people started going out again, and stopped listening in on audio chats on the Internet.

Twitter Spaces is not doing great either, but it doesn’t really matter because it’s just a feature, not a whole business.
